Starting next November 7, companies and associations operating in the cultural, creative and tourism sectors will be able to submit the application for 'Cultura Crea Plus', the incentive for companies affected by the Covid-19 emergency.
The incentive — promoted by the Ministry of Culture and managed by Invitalia — consists of a non-repayable contribution to cover working capital expenses up to a maximum of 25,000 euros, necessary for restarting and supporting businesses.
The financial envelope is 10 million euros. The measure uses funds from the PON FESR “Culture and Development” 2014-2020 (Priority Axis
II).
Cultura Crea Plus is aimed at micro, small and medium-sized enterprises and third sector entities (non-profit organizations, social promotion associations) established on January 1, 2020 and exercising economic activity as of December 31, 2020, attributable to the list of admitted ATECO codes (annexes 1, 2 and 3 to Operating Directive 238 of 29 March 2021).
In particular, with reference to the date of submission of the application:
— for companies established less than 36 months ago, the headquarters must be located in one of the following regions: Campania, Puglia, Basilicata, Calabria and Sicily;
— for companies established for more than 36 months and for third sector entities, the headquarters must be located in one of the municipalities falling within the “areas of attraction” as identified by Annex 4 to Operating Directive 238 of
29 March 2021.
The application can be submitted online, starting at 10 a.m. on November 7, 2022, through the Invitalia IT platform. The evaluation takes place within 60 days, based on the chronological order of arrival
.
